use std::io::{self, IsTerminal, Write};
use owo_colors::OwoColorize;
pub fn is_color_enabled() -> bool {
if std::env::var_os("NO_COLOR").is_some() {
return false;
}
if std::env::var("CLICOLOR") == Ok("0".to_owned()) {
return false;
}
io::stdout().is_terminal()
}
pub fn with_color(enabled: bool) -> ColorMode {
ColorMode { enabled }
}
